Readeck Save is a powerful AI agent skill that extends your assistant with new capabilities. Save articles to Readeck (self-hosted read-it-later app). Use when the user wants to save an article for later reading, add something to their reading list, or send a page to Readeck. Option 1: Install via CLI (recommended)
Recommended (no pre-install needed)
npx clawhub@latest --dir ~/.claude/skills install readeck-saveOr via clawhub CLI (if already installed)
clawhub --dir ~/.claude/skills install readeck-saveβ οΈ Requires Node.js 18+. No Node? Use Option 2 below to download the ZIP instead. Install Node.js β
Option 2: Manual install (no Node required)
Download the ZIP, extract it, and place the folder at the path below. Restart your agent to activate.
Install path
~/.claude/skills/readeck-save/π‘Extract and place the folder at the path above, then restart your agent.
